macOS is the Apple operating system. It is popular for its excellent security. System Integrity Protection, or SIP, is one of the primary security components in this regard. First introduced in OS X El Capitan, it prevents malware from changing the system files and processes.
Even though SIP offers an effective layer of defence, new vulnerabilities have popped up, so it is an important issue that all macOS users should know.
System Integrity Protection is a security feature that limits what the root user can do to parts of the macOS file system that are protected. This helps keep key system files and directories from being modified or changed by malware applications, for example. It is pretty hard for malware to avoid its protection because SIP runs at a very low level within the operating system.

Although SIP has a strong protective measure, recent reports have highlighted vulnerabilities within SIP that could be exploited by attackers. These vulnerabilities can allow malicious software to bypass SIP protections and gain unauthorized access to critical system files.
One such vulnerability is with SIP interacting with certain kernel extensions. An attacker could exploit this vulnerability to turn off SIP protections for a time or even alter protected files. This has caused significant concerns among users, who use their Macs to conduct sensitive operations such as online banking or managing personal information.
Another weakness lies in the way third-party applications may interact with SIP-protected regions. Applications can inadvertently expose vulnerabilities that an attacker can take advantage of. For example, if a user installs a compromised application that needs elevated permissions, it may inadvertently disable or weaken SIP protections.
The implications of these vulnerabilities are severe. If an attacker succeeds in bypassing SIP protections, then they can change system files. They can install malware into the system or even take control of the whole system. This could lead to data breaches, loss of personal information, and other security-related issues.

Several best practices can be followed to mitigate the risks associated with SIP vulnerabilities:
Keep Software Updated: Keeping macOS and all applications installed updated is essential for receiving the latest security patches and improvements. Apple often pushes out updates that correct known vulnerabilities.
Use Trusted Sources: Always download applications from trusted sources, such as the Mac App Store or the official developer's website. Never install software from unknown or suspicious sites.
Enable Firewall: The built-in firewall of macOS offers an extra layer of protection against unauthorized access. Activation of a firewall is useful in blocking many potential threats.
Review Permissions: Application permissions should be reviewed frequently, and only permit those applications to access files they need for purposes of execution. Be careful while giving elevated permission to third-party software.
Backup Data: Maintain the availability of data through regular backups. This would be for restoring purposes in case a security breach has occurred. Time Machine or any backup solution can be used to provide peace of mind.
Educate About Phishing: Being aware of phishing and other types of social engineering tactics can prevent unauthorized access to a system. Users should not respond to unsolicited emails or messages requesting personal information.
